The is a high-end audio compressor plugin that emulates an extremely rare 1954 German analog hardware unit. It was developed by NEOLD and is distributed via Plugin Alliance . The original hardware was custom-built by in Hamburg for the post-war NWDR (Northwest German Broadcasting) network. Only a few dozen units were ever produced, primarily used to boost signal-to-noise ratios in AM radio transmissions.
